Dallas Stars Crush Tampa Bay Lightning in 8-1 Victory
Seven Different Goal Scorers Contribute to Win as Lightning Suffer Fourth Consecutive Loss
- The Dallas Stars dominated the Tampa Bay Lightning in an 8-1 victory, with seven different goal scorers contributing to the win.
- Jason Robertson scored twice, and Joe Pavelski had a goal and two assists, helping the Dallas Stars race out to an early 3-0 lead.
- The eight goals matched a season high for Dallas and are the most allowed by Tampa Bay.
- Victor Hedman scored for the Lightning, who have now lost four consecutive games for the first time this season.
- The teams will complete the home-and-home series at Tampa Bay on Monday.
